While Castleford Station may lack some of the more comprehensive facilities of larger stations, it is equipped to meet essential travel needs. Though there's no staffed ticket office, all travelers can conveniently collect their tickets from accessible ticket machines available at the station. Smartcard holders will find validators on-site to streamline their journey.
Accessibility is a strong point of Castleford, as step-free access is available throughout the station ensuring ease for passengers with mobility concerns. The station has also been equipped with lifts between platforms, allowing for more comfortable travel across the station’s premises. For those with hearing difficulties, an induction loop is available, and assistance at the station can be coordinated via the help points or the conductor on your train.
When visiting Castleford, you're not limited to rail. Those requiring alternate transport options can rest easy knowing that bus services and taxis are within reach. A bus stop is located conveniently close to the station, making it an easy choice for local travels. For those preferring cabs, taxi services can be explored through Cab4You, ensuring a seamless transition from train to vehicle.
For the environmentally conscious or fitness enthusiasts, bicycle storage is available within the car park, although bicycle hire is not offered on-site. The station boasts an array of amenities designed to ease your travel experience. You’ll find ticket machines strategically placed at the main entrance and Station Road entrance, making it simple to collect tickets purchased online. An induction loop is available for those with hearing aids, ensuring everyone can access information comfortably. While there might not be a plethora of shopping or dining options at the station, basic facilities like toilets, including accessible ones and baby changing facilities, are present to accommodate your needs.
Langley (Berks) is committed to accessibility, offering full step-free access across all platforms. Though there isn’t a physical waiting room, platforms offer ample seating. There’s a focus on ensuring travel ease for everyone, with staff assistance and ramps for train boarding readily available. CCTV ensures safety while traveling, and customer help points are strategically located for any queries or assistance needed.
Getting to and from Langley (Berks) Train Station doesn’t stop at the train. The station is well-integrated with various transport modes to facilitate broader travel. For those needing to cover the last mile by road, there are taxi services available. If you’re aiming for international travel, Heathrow Airport is accessible via the Elizabeth Line with a change at Hayes & Harlington, or a direct bus service using the number 7 from Harrow Market, Stop B.
